From what I understand, the rise of the brony is really kind of perplexing and a take on society as a whole.

All of us should know the rise of 'My Little Pony' and why it has attracted so many men between the ages of 18 - 35. They will say that the characters, stories, animation and overall depth of the show has just called to them and they truly enjoy it. So, for men who enjoy the show, they call themselves 'bronies'.

But, I heard a reason it has become so popular is actually a part of a large societal shift in our culture. For many generations, boys had boy things and girls had girl things. Back in the day, boys enjoyed sports, war, fighting and later on comics and video games. Girls enjoyed dolls, playing house and dress up then later on enjoyed Barbie's and Strawberry Shortcake. There were shows and media that was marketed and created for each of these genders. Transformers for boys and Rainbow Bright for girls.

In the past decade or two, that gender line has began to become blurry. Mostly, girls have begun to enjoy boys interests. Girls love comic books, video games, transformers and every other general boy interests. So, now a days, you will see comic books and video games marketed especially to girls because they actually exist in those markets.

With girls enjoying boy stuff, it has not really been in reverse. Boys don't like Disney Princesses. Boys don't like Barbies. Boys aren't supposed to like My Little Pony. Why? Because they would be made fun of by their peer groups.

Bronies are a stand up against that prejudice. They are usually straight boys that love something girlish, but are still masculine and boyish. They are fighting the stereotype that boys can't like girlish things.

From what I have heard, that is the deeper and social meaning behind the Bronies.
